Output 8baf54d766e69f4d6e4f723aabe10bbab28fbda5ce8e5107e7801362dcf8fe6d:8

value
20583552
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c50dd810df9ec9b8a5bc0f25665cb8378bb268e OP_EQUALVERIFY OP_CHECKSIG
address
1Q189xXbD4J1eRH2fe8Ep1yzuZ2kv5aScu
transaction
8baf54d766e69f4d6e4f723aabe10bbab28fbda5ce8e5107e7801362dcf8fe6d
confirmations
170608
spent
true